Outcomes following treatment

Outcomes DA (n=14)a BAP (n=15)b P-value
Immediate
Technical success 14 (100.0) 15 (100.0) 1.0
Procedural success 12 (85.7) 11 (73.3) 0.651
Residual stenosis >30%c 1 (7.1) 0 (0.0) 0.483
Distal embolizationd 1 (7.1) 2 (13.3) 1.0
Flow-limiting dissectione 0 (0.0) 2 (13.3) 0.483
One-year follow-up
Ankle-brachial index 0.82±0.17 0.80±0.19 0.124
Primary patency 12 (85.7) 11 (73.3) 0.411
Target lesion revascularization 2 (14.3) 3 (20.0) 0.684
Secondary patency 14 (100.0) 14 (93.3) 0.326

Values are presented as number (%) or mean±standard deviation

DA, directional atherectomy; BAP, balloon angioplasty

aDA followed by BAP group. bBAP only group. cTreated by repeated BAP. dTreated by aspiration embolectomy. eTreated by bailout stenting
